Recopie d'une colonne selon un choix...

  • Initiateur de la discussion bigbig
  • Date de début
B

bigbig

Guest
Bonjour à tous,

Un petit problème pour créer une formule...

Je cherche en formule (et non pas en macro) à faire la recopie d'une colonne.
Le résultat est toujours à l'emplacement des '?'.
Le choix de la colonne se fait en fonction de la valeur de 'Val'.
Sur la ligne L1, on cherche la valeur égale à 'Val', et c'est cette colonne que l'on désire recopier.

A noter que les valeurs de la ligne L1 ne sont pas fixe mais résultent d'un calcul indépendant et donc peuvent varié

Par exemple, j'ai le tableau suivant :

L1 : 5 3 2 4 1 6 Val
L2 : 1 3 5 1 6 5 ?
L3 : 5 6 0 2 6 4 ?
L4 : 5 1 6 1 6 2 ?

Si Val = 3 alors, je recopie la 2ème colonne : 3 6 1.

Si Val = 1 alors, je recopie la 5ème colonne : 6 6 6.

Quel formule mettre dans les case '?'

Merci de votre aide, A+
 
B

bigbig

Guest
Ca y est, j'ai trouvé sur :
Ce lien n'existe plus

La formule dans '?' :
=INDEX(Tableau_de_données;;EQUIV($Val;$L1;1))

Et faire attention au dernier paramètre de EQUIV selon valeur exacte ou pas.

Et pour recopier la formule, attention aux $

A+
 

Discussions similaires

Réponses
5
Affichages
159
Réponses
8
Affichages
445

Statistiques des forums

Discussions
312 345
Messages
2 087 450
Membres
103 546
dernier inscrit
mohamed tano